The Significance Of Credit Score

People can be prevented from reaching many desired objectives or locate it much tougher to reach them when they have a negative credit rating. Someone who would prefer to acquire a house may recognize that it really is considerably tough to follow this dream with a bad credit rating.

It might also be difficult to acquire a car loan or perhaps a certain job unless you have a great credit score. Frequently, best mortgage lenders and other lenders do their very own evaluation and choose if a credit rating is poor or great.

In several instances, it is the expectations from the lender that decide if a credit rating is poor. As an example, a mortgage company might decide that poor credit means something falling beneath a 620 rating although majority lenders or creditors do not stipulate what tends to make a credit rating bad or good. To create a decision that a credit rating is bad, they usually assess what can be deemed as a advantageous threat for the company. Then they determine on the level that’s accepted and not accepted.

Several creditors might use different methods to determine what represents a bad credit rating but an individual can decide whether or not or not existing credit rating will probably be considered as getting poor by finding out what creditors are asking for on typical.

For instance, if most of the lenders in a certain region favor that borrowers’ score be 680 or more and individuals realize that their credit score is 500 or much less, then they’ll already understand that it really is hardly most likely for them to acquire credit with that rate. In short, when a credit rating is high, the likelihood of acquiring credit will be high and when a person’s credit score is deemed bad, it’ll be less likely for that person to obtain loans or credits.

Repair Bad Credit Report – There Are No Credit Repair Secrets

The first thing you need to do is get a copy of your credit report.  You can do so at www.annualcreditreport.com If you want to take a look at your credit score, you can buy it for about ten bucks at that site too.The underlying information in your credit report is what goes into your FICO credit score.Get your free credit report and check to make sure everything in there should be there.  You cannot delete accurate negative items, you just have to wait those out.You can file an online dispute with the credit rating companies and get the incorrect info deleted.  So do a credit report dispute to get those items corrected and repair bad credit.

If you make late payments every few months or even just once or twice a year, your score will go down.  You need to setup automatic payments so you can have all your bills paid on time.  You won’t have any late fees this way either. 

Next you are going to want to decrease your credit utilization ratio.  This is how much of your available credit you are using.  You can increase your credit limits or decrease what you owe.  Both ways can help you.This one tip may be a challenge because many banks are hesitant to increase credit lines. 

Another way to boost your credit score and improve your credit rating is to not close old accounts.  Your credit history is a big portion of what makes up your score so if you close all your 5, 7 and 10 year old accounts, you erase this part of your past and it lowers your score.  So follow these well known steps and you can start repairing your bad credit report and getting better rates on your loans and credit cards.
